Course Content

• Understanding Dermatillomania: Symptoms, Diagnosis, and Differential Diagnosis
•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) for Dermatillomania: Techniques and Applications
•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T) Skills for Managing Urges and Emotions
• Mindfulness-Based Interventions for Dermatillomania: Stress Reduction and Self-Awareness
•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T) for Skin Picking: Values Clarification and Behavior Change
• Relapse Prevention Strategies for Sustained Recovery from Dermatillomania
• The Role of Comorbid Conditions (e.g., anxiety, depression, OCD) in Dermatillomania
• Evidence-Based Treatment Planning and Case Management for Dermatillomania Intervention
• Supporting Clients and Families Affected by Dermatillomania: Communication and Coping Strategies
